This section highlights the job market trends in this field, represented through a 3D pie chart that showcases the percentage distribution of various roles. 1. **Waste Management Specialist**: These professionals play a crucial role in managing waste disposal, recycling, and reduction strategies for businesses and organizations. With a focus on sustainability, these specialists help reduce environmental impact and promote resource efficiency. 2. **Sustainability Consultant**: As a sustainability consultant, you'll help organizations adopt environmentally friendly practices, reduce their carbon footprint, and develop eco-conscious strategies. These professionals often work with various industries to ensure compliance with environmental regulations and promote sustainable development. 3. **Circular Economy Analyst**: Circular economy analysts study and develop strategies aimed at reducing waste, promoting resource efficiency, and creating a circular flow of materials. They analyze business operations, identify areas for improvement, and recommend sustainable alternatives. 4. **Closed-Loop Systems Engineer**: These engineers work on designing, implementing, and optimizing closed-loop systems that aim to minimize waste by reusing and recycling materials. They focus on creating efficient, sustainable, and eco-friendly manufacturing processes and product life cycles. 5. **Green Supply Chain Manager**: Green supply chain managers are responsible for overseeing the entire supply chain process, from sourcing raw materials to delivering finished products, while ensuring minimal environmental impact. They work on reducing waste, conserving resources, and promoting sustainability throughout the supply chain. 6. **Eco-Design Architect**: Eco-design architects specialize in creating environmentally friendly and sustainable building designs. They incorporate green technologies, renewable energy sources, and energy-efficient materials in their projects to reduce the overall carbon footprint and promote sustainable living. These roles demonstrate the growing demand for professionals with expertise in circular economy and closed-loop systems.
